Introduction to Aluminum Pergolas

Aluminum pergolas are gaining popularity in Arizona due to their durability, low maintenance requirements, and aesthetic appeal. Unlike traditional wood pergolas, aluminum structures resist rotting, warping, and pest damage, making them ideal for the harsh desert climate.

Benefits of Aluminum Pergolas

1. Climate Control: Aluminum pergolas can be designed with integrated heaters for cooler evenings and retractable canopies for additional shade during hot days, providing year-round comfort.

2. Customization: They can be tailored to fit any outdoor space, offering options for partial or full sun protection and adjustable settings.

3. Maintenance: Aluminum pergolas require minimal upkeep, as they do not need painting or sealing and can be cleaned with soap and water.

4. Strength and Versatility: High-quality aluminum, such as 4K Aluminum, offers strength, durability, and design flexibility, allowing for longer beam spans and modern designs.

Customization Options for Aluminum Pergolas

Customizing your aluminum pergola allows you to create a unique outdoor space that reflects your personal style and complements your home's architecture. Here are some ways you can customize your aluminum pergola:

1. Design and Style

- Lattice Top: A lattice top design provides partial shade while allowing breezes to pass through, perfect for maintaining a connection with nature.

- Solid Roof: For full sun protection, a solid roof can be installed, offering complete coverage and protection from the elements.

- Louvered Roof: This modern design features adjustable slats that can be tilted to control sunlight and airflow, offering precision and elegance.

2. Materials and Finishes

- Alumawood: Offers a wood-like texture without the maintenance issues of real wood, available in various colors and finishes.

- 4K Aluminum: Known for its strength, durability, and modern aesthetic, ideal for creating sleek and contemporary designs.

3. Color and Texture

- Color Options: Aluminum pergolas come in a range of colors to match your home's exterior and personal preferences.

- Texture: Alumawood provides a rich wood texture, while aluminum can offer a sleek, modern finish.

4. Size and Layout

- Free-Standing or Attached: Pergolas can be installed as standalone structures or attached to your home, depending on your space and needs.

- Curved or Straight Edges: Customize the shape to fit your patio's design, whether it's curved for a softer look or straight for a more modern feel.

5. Accessories and Features

- Integrated Lighting: Add ambiance with built-in lighting options that highlight your pergola's design and create a cozy atmosphere in the evenings.

- Planting Options: Incorporate climbing vines or plants around your pergola for natural shade and beauty.

Installation Process

Installing an aluminum pergola is relatively straightforward, but it's essential to follow a structured approach to ensure a successful project. Here's a simplified guide:

1. Plan Your Design: Decide on the size, style, and features you want for your pergola.

2. Choose Materials: Select high-quality aluminum or Alumawood for durability and aesthetic appeal.

3. Prepare the Site: Clear the area where the pergola will be installed, ensuring it's level and free of debris.

4. Install Posts: Secure the posts to the ground or deck using appropriate anchors.

5. Assemble the Frame: Attach the beams and rafters according to your design.

6. Add Roofing or Lattice: Install the chosen roofing material or lattice top.

7. Final Touches: Add any accessories like lighting or plantings.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What Materials Are Best for Pergolas in Arizona?

Aluminum and Alumawood are highly recommended for pergolas in Arizona due to their resistance to heat, sun damage, and low maintenance requirements.

2. How Much Does a Pergola Cost?

The cost of a pergola can vary widely, from about $1,000 for a small prefab kit to $9,000 or more for custom designs, depending on materials and installation complexity.

3. Can I Build a Pergola Myself?

Yes, building a pergola can be a DIY project, but it requires some carpentry skills and knowledge. For complex designs, hiring a professional is recommended.

4. What Are the Benefits of a Louvered Pergola?

A louvered pergola offers adjustable slats that can be tilted to control sunlight and airflow, providing precision and elegance while maintaining a modern aesthetic.

5. How Do I Maintain My Aluminum Pergola?

Maintenance is minimal; simply wash the pergola with soap and water periodically to keep it looking new. No painting or sealing is required.
